Spb Software House Releases Spb Pocket PC Tips & Tricks  Tuesday, December 14 2004

Spb Software House, a leading Pocket PC software developer, releases Spb Pocket PC Tips & Tricks - the most complete collection of more than 200 tips and tricks on using the Pocket PC, written by 10 professional Pocket PC authors.

Spb Software House has always paid a lot of attention to improving the overall Pocket PC user experience. We have developed many programs that have helped people to get much more from their Pocket PC. But we have found out that there are still a lot of Pocket PC users who do not use all the power of the built-in Pocket PC programs, and are completely unaware of the many useful things their Pocket PC's can do for them.

How can I type faster? Is it possible to store twice as much music on my storage card without suffering quality loss? How can I watch a DVD movie on my Pocket PC without expensive converters? Does password protection completely protect my data from intruders? What is the best GPS available for my Pocket PC?

There are many questions just like these that not all Pocket PC users know the answer to, but almost all want to know. So, we came up with the idea to create a special application that would contain answers to many Pocket PC related questions and also provide a lot of tips and tricks. To make our idea a reality, we have cooperated with 10 of the most talented, experienced, and well-known Pocket PC authors in the mobile world. Moreover, we wanted to maximize the readability and usability of our program as much as possible. So, now the fruit of our collaboration is Spb Pocket PC Tips & Tricks.


*** About The Authors ***

For people who try to keep up with the ever-changing Pocket PC world, the names of our authors will speak volumes. Most of them are experts and gurus in the PDA world because they maintain or, at least regularly contribute for the most popular Pocket PC related websites, such as Geekzone.co.nz, pocketnow.com, PDAGold.com, PocketPCThoughts.com and others.

Each topic is written by the author who is most experienced in that area. For example, the GPS topic is written by Andreu Ares who has been the moderator of the GPS forum over at TodoPocketPC.com for the last 3 years. Also, the Phone Edition is written by Darryl Burling, who is well-known as an expert in Pocket PC Phone Edition questions.


*** Pricing ***

One can download a free trial version, which contains one tip in each section to get an idea of what the whole topic would be like. The full version costs $19.95.
